Vivien
Premium Review Leo' 125. (88 words)
by - written on 12/06/00 (Useful, 891 readings)
Rating:

Great scooter for the city commuter. This cosworth beater at traffic lights has caused many a motorist, to stare after me in disbelief, when they are left standing. It cuts through snarl ups with the greatest of ease and completes a 40 minute rush hour car journey in about 12 minutes. With good fuel consumption this bike will have paid for itself in 2 years just in the petrol savings when compared to my car.Only complaint was from a pillion rider who felt exposed perched high on the back. ...  Read the complete review
